집 >데이터 베이스 >MySQL 튜토리얼 >DataTables와 함께 ssp.class.php를 사용하여 테이블을 조인하려면 어떻게 해야 합니까?
ssp.class.php를 사용하여 테이블 결합
jQuery용 DataTables 테이블 플러그인은 데이터를 테이블 형식으로 표시하는 편리한 방법을 제공합니다. 그러나 자체적으로 테이블 조인을 지원하지는 않습니다. 이는 여러 테이블의 데이터를 표시해야 하는 경우 제한이 될 수 있습니다.
SSP로 테이블 조인
SSP(서버 측 처리)는 다음을 허용하는 기술입니다. 클라이언트에 데이터를 보내기 전에 서버 측에서 데이터를 처리해야 합니다. 이를 통해 처리로 인해 클라이언트측에 과부하를 주지 않고도 테이블 조인과 같은 복잡한 작업을 수행할 수 있습니다.
ssp.class.php 라이브러리는 서버 작업에 사용할 수 있는 널리 사용되는 PHP 라이브러리입니다. DataTable을 사용한 부차적 처리. 그러나 기본적으로 조인을 지원하지 않습니다. ssp.class.php를 사용하여 테이블을 조인하려면 해결 방법을 사용해야 합니다.
구현 예
$table = <<<EOT ( SELECT a.id, a.name, a.father_id, b.name AS father_name FROM table a LEFT JOIN table b ON a.father_id = b.id ) temp EOT; $primaryKey = 'id'; $columns = array( array( 'db' => 'id', 'dt' => 0 ), array( 'db' => 'name', 'dt' => 1 ), array( 'db' => 'father_id', 'dt' => 2 ), array( 'db' => 'father_name', 'dt' => 3 ) ); $sql_details = array( 'user' => '', 'pass' => '', 'db' => '', 'host' => '' ); require 'ssp.class.php'; echo json_encode( SSP::simple( $_GET, $sql_details, $table, $primaryKey, $columns ) );
추가 참고 사항
위 내용은 DataTables와 함께 ssp.class.php를 사용하여 테이블을 조인하려면 어떻게 해야 합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!